Perioperative Healthcare Assistant

3 months ago


Kingston upon Thames, Greater London, United Kingdom The New Victoria Hospital Full time

We are looking for a Perioperative Health Care Assistant to join our team of nurses working in the Theatres department.

The role will aid in assisting the multi-disciplinary theatre team in providing high quality care for patients in the theatre department, ensuring patient dignity and privacy and an excellent patient experience.


Requirements:

Knowledge:

  • Understanding of the role and what is expected of them
  • Experience (depending on position):_
  • Minimum of 6 months experience within a perioperative (or equivalent) setting
  • Planning and organising skills
  • Qualifications:_
  • Educated to GCSE or equivalent (including English and Maths)
  • Level 2 / Level 3 NVQ in Health and Social Care (Perioperative Care-Surgical Support); _
    desirable_
  • Skills and Aptitude:_
  • Exceptional communicator
  • Ability to work as part of a team
  • Ability to follow instructions
  • Logical and methodical
  • Good literacy and numeracy skills
  • IT skills; _
    desirable_
